ROBERT H. JACKSON
(1892-1954) Supreme Court Associate Justice who also took on the role of chief U.S. prosecutor at the Nurnberg war crimes trials. T.L.S. signed with initials, 1p. 4to., Oct. 2, 1952, on his Supreme Court letterhead to writer Eugene Gerhard. In part: "...The whole issue between the biographer of Hughes and the President, is one of accuracy of recollection. On Hughes' part there is a perfectly consistent, long-continued recollection of one thing. On the other hand, the President has now shown that his own recollection is completely unreliable by giving an account that is patently at odds with all the facts in the case. The President's recollection is now not only in conflict with that of Hughes, but in conflict with itself. Few men seeking material for a book have such a thing tossed into their laps...". File and staple holes at top, very good.
